Tonle Sap Lake and Kampong Phluk Half-Day Tours from Siem Reap (4-5h)

Overview

Half-day group tour from Siem Reap with a local guide. Enjoy your the tour in the morning or afternoon with about 45-minutes’ drive to the fishermen’s village of Kompong Phluk whose name means 'harbor of the tusks' and Cambodia great lake. Enjoy Tonle Sap Lake, it’s a lake with no ends in front of you, birds flying slowly overhead and surrounding with the interesting village as well as wetland area.

A local boat ride take you the Tonle Sap Lake and village where you will see nature in a way you’ve only seen in picture books and it’s where you will now see villagers houses, school, government houses built on high stilts but the pagoda on the only butte (the only building which is not on stilts) and see the activities of the villagers who your expert guide will teach you about their culture, the life style, and the ecosystem of this fascinating place.

Itinerary

Begin your adventure with pickup from your Siem Reap hotel for the roughly 45-minute journey to Kompong Phluk. Depending on the season, you’ll travel by minibus (February to July) or by minibus and boat (August to January). Transfer to a small boat and set sail along the lake, passing stilted houses and schools, floating markets, pagodas, and fishing boats as your guide tells you more about local life, customs, and traditions. 

Wet-season visitors can also opt to enjoy a traditional canoe ride around the flooded forests (for an additional expense) and experience the region’s unique ecosystem as you glide between the semi-submerged trees. 

Back in Siem Reap, your tour ends with a drop-off at your hotel.
